Matt Koss wrote:
> >
> >I like the idea of a "progress-info-server"  ... but I think we have
> >to provide ALSO the usual way of emitting progress info, for caitoo,
> >konqueror's progress bar, ... and other apps that want detailed reports.
> >Any other app using Job or NetAccess to simply download/upload should
> >rely on the server to display the progress information.
> 
> I agree.
> 
> Coolo, Taj ?
> 
me? I just added a comment Taj made :)
As a mater of fact, the progress infos come out of the library only.
I don't want to see progress related code in Job except the signals.
I would rather like to have class that can connect to all job signals
itself. This class in return would send it's infos to the GUI-server by
default. But caitoo and konqueror could also provide this class on it's
own. libkio should have only the default IMO.
But you know best what signals you need, so I would start with adding
the
signals to job.
